From cb74876aa4c9e81eab4f1f0fa4967988f708db15 Mon Sep 17 00:00:00 2001
From: Scott Moser <smoser@ubuntu.com>
Date: Fri, 10 Jun 2016 14:49:34 -0400
Subject: fix one large source of leaked tmpfiles

---
 tests/unittests/test_datasource/test_smartos.py | 4 +++-
 1 file changed, 3 insertions(+), 1 deletion(-)

(limited to 'tests')

diff --git a/tests/unittests/test_datasource/test_smartos.py b/tests/unittests/test_datasource/test_smartos.py
index c809117b..ec57cff1 100644
--- a/tests/unittests/test_datasource/test_smartos.py
+++ b/tests/unittests/test_datasource/test_smartos.py
@@ -146,7 +146,9 @@ class TestSmartOSDataSource(FilesystemMockingTestCase):
         self.addCleanup(shutil.rmtree, self.tmp)
         self.paths = c_helpers.Paths({'cloud_dir': self.tmp})
 
-        self.legacy_user_d = tempfile.mkdtemp()
+        self.legacy_user_d = os.path.join(self.tmp, 'legacy_user_tmp')
+        os.mkdir(self.legacy_user_d)
+
         self.orig_lud = DataSourceSmartOS.LEGACY_USER_D
         DataSourceSmartOS.LEGACY_USER_D = self.legacy_user_d
 
-- 
cgit v1.2.3


From 2d3eb3a5730208b84e141f08df10f23c1447fdb5 Mon Sep 17 00:00:00 2001
From: Scott Moser <smoser@ubuntu.com>
Date: Fri, 10 Jun 2016 15:00:52 -0400
Subject: one more

---
 tests/unittests/test_datasource/test_azure_helper.py | 2 ++
 1 file changed, 2 insertions(+)

(limited to 'tests')

diff --git a/tests/unittests/test_datasource/test_azure_helper.py b/tests/unittests/test_datasource/test_azure_helper.py
index d07a1f07..9a15d15e 100644
--- a/tests/unittests/test_datasource/test_azure_helper.py
+++ b/tests/unittests/test_datasource/test_azure_helper.py
@@ -1,4 +1,5 @@
 import os
+import shutil
 
 from cloudinit.sources.helpers import azure as azure_helper
 
@@ -288,6 +289,7 @@ class TestOpenSSLManager(TestCase):
         self.subp.side_effect = capture_directory
         manager = azure_helper.OpenSSLManager()
         self.assertEqual(manager.tmpdir, subp_directory['path'])
+        manager.clean_up()
 
     @mock.patch.object(azure_helper, 'cd', mock.MagicMock())
     @mock.patch.object(azure_helper.tempfile, 'mkdtemp', mock.MagicMock())
-- 
cgit v1.2.3


From 785fe5632d58633dea5d6b2c1c5ecbaca35471a3 Mon Sep 17 00:00:00 2001
From: Scott Moser <smoser@ubuntu.com>
Date: Fri, 10 Jun 2016 15:03:24 -0400
Subject: remove unused import

---
 tests/unittests/test_datasource/test_azure_helper.py | 1 -
 1 file changed, 1 deletion(-)

(limited to 'tests')

diff --git a/tests/unittests/test_datasource/test_azure_helper.py b/tests/unittests/test_datasource/test_azure_helper.py
index 9a15d15e..70e8f7f2 100644
--- a/tests/unittests/test_datasource/test_azure_helper.py
+++ b/tests/unittests/test_datasource/test_azure_helper.py
@@ -1,5 +1,4 @@
 import os
-import shutil
 
 from cloudinit.sources.helpers import azure as azure_helper
 
-- 
cgit v1.2.3